能源统计对能源管理及能源发展规划和战略具有重要意义。能源加总是能源统计中的基本问题之一。我国能源加总方法以热当量法为基础,然而该方法仅考虑了不同能源‘量’的属性而忽略了其‘质’的属性,因此加总结果不能正确反映出不同能源的真实价值。为把影响能源价值的主要因素包含在能源加总中,本文对现有文献中提及的四种方法进行了对比分析,指出Divisia能源指数方法是较好的能源加总方法。并用Divisia理想能源指数和热当量法对吐哈油田2001~2010年的油气产出进行了实证性对比,指出了能源定价问题是影响Divisia计算方法准确性的因素,并给出了完善意见。
Energy statistics play an important role in energy management and energy planning and strate- gic development. Energy aggregation is one of the essential issues among energy statistics. In China, it is based on thermal equivalent,.method. However, this method only involves the quantity rather than quality of energy, so that the aggregation cannot correctly reflect the real value of different energy resources. Consider- ing the attribute of quality, this paper shows four methods from literature research and draws the conclusion that Divisia index approach is the best. What is more, it provides an empirical analysis of the aggregation of oil and gas output of Tuha Oilfield (2001-2010) by using the Divisia index and thermal equivalent method. It also points out that the energy pricing has become the factor to influence the accuracy of Divisia index, and provides further perfect opinions.
